Serving 51 students in grades 6-12, Camp Verde Accommodation School ranks in the bottom 50% of all schools in Arizona for overall test scores (math proficiency is bottom 50%, and reading proficiency is bottom 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is ≤10% (which is lower than the Arizona state average of 34%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is ≤20% (which is lower than the Arizona state average of 40%).
Minority enrollment is 55%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is lower than the Arizona state average of 67% (majority Hispanic).

Camp Verde Accommodation School's student population of 51 students has grown by 537% over five school years.
The teacher population of 1 teachers has stayed relatively flat over five school years.
